    Winter in Boulder is anything but Cold

         I grew up in Chicago and when winter came rolling around it was time for one thing……staying warm.  Here in Boulder, things are a bit different.  With a much more mild winter climate, Boulder offers plenty of winter activities to keep you active and warm. 

         Countless groups and organizations offer winter hikes and activites.  Such as the Flatirons Ski club, which will take you all over the state to ski Colorado.  Both nordic and downhill skiing are available.  What a great way to get outside and meet new people.

    One of my personal favorite Clubs is known as FIDOS or Friends Interested in Dogs and Open Space.  If you have a dog, love the outdoors and enjoy meeting people in your community this is a great club for you.  These two organizations are just a few of the the local groups which help make our winters a bit more fulfilling.  Click HERE to see more local organizations…. FIDOS

         Near the Boulder 1 Plaza lies a small ice rink for local skaters to get their fix on.  Who doesn’t enjoy ice skating and hot coco?  Head down there on wed. or Thursday nights and watch a new game that is taking off in popularity here in Boulder.  It is known as Broomball.  A game that mixes hockey and good times into one.  With a brooom-like stick, large ball, and pads teams face off to beat one another in some pretty good competition.  Weather it is 8 degrees or 40, these Broom ball gurus are out there battling for local pride.   For those of you who want a bit more compeition in their Broomball games there is an indoor league at the local rec center you can join. 

    Another local Boulder benefit is done by a guy who appreciates a good cross country course.  I met this individual a few years ago and trust me he only does it for the people. :)   Every time we get a fresh snow he heads out in his truck and grooms a track for cross country skiiers at Morning Side Park, near 9th and Balsam.  From six in the morning to six at night you can find outdoor junkies getting a good workout in or just enjoying the snow.  It is worth the effort and we thank you Boulder Groomer.
